Release 2.2

- Switch to hybrid S6
- **Added --regex option** TheCaptain989/lidarr-flac2mp3#33
- **Added optional use of environment variable** TheCaptain989/lidarr-flac2mp3#33
- **Added new --tags option to resolve TheCaptain989/lidarr-flac2mp3#15**
- Added checks for identical track name
- Recycled files are now moved to subdirectory paths that more closely resemble the original path
- Better error handling in awk script when calling system commands
- Added logging for skipped tracks
- Corrected some logging anomalies
- Modified exit codes
- Updated command line help
- Fixed missing executable attribute on some script files
- Updated README
